How much do overnight visitor services j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 26, 2026, the average hourly pay for overnight visitor services in the United States is $24.45,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.83 and $31.49 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

Position Title: Visitor Services Assistant - AmeriCorps

Conservation Legacy Program: Stewards Individual Placements

Site Location: Pinnacles National Park

5000 East Entrance Road, Piacines, CA 95043

Terms of Service:

  • Start Date: September 14, 2026
  • End Date: August 27, 2027
  • AmeriCorps Slot Classification: 1700 Hours, 50 weeks

Purpose:

Stewards Individual Placements (Stewards), a program of Conservation Legacy, provides individuals with AmeriCorps service and career opportunities to strengthen communities and preserve our natural resources. Participants serve with federal agencies, tribal governments, and nonprofits to provide institutional capacity, develop community relationships, and support ecosystem health. Stewards in partnership with the Pinnacles National Park will host a Visitor Services Assistant.

The Visitor Services Assistant is an AmeriCorps position that will assist with providing interpretive services to visitors.


Description of Duties:

Answers a wide variety of visitor questions with an explanation and description that evokes a discussion of subject matter.
Provide general information about local facilities, pertinent rules, and regulations, and other regular inquires.
Provides public orientation and explanations of current park events and informs visitors of potential safety hazards.
Providing talks following a prescribed outline and requiring application of broad Pinnacles specific interpretive themes.
Create content for web, NPS app and social media platforms related to Pinnacle's core interpretive themes.
Respond to email, voicemail, phone calls, and postal mail requests for information.
Provide on-trail assistance that requires hiking for extended periods of time focusing on visitor safety.
Gathers information from reporting parties concerning incidents within the park and notifies appropriate personnel.
Attend off site community events to promote park themes and programs.
Provides a wide range of services to visitors, including assistance with lost articles, car trouble, and first aid.
Uses and maintains a variety of technology equipment and assists other staff in the performance of clerical work.
Assist with weekend traffic operations.
Work with other divisions team members and interns to develop a broad understand to park management operations.
Performs minor maintenance duties to ensure a clean, safe work area.
Follow safety protocols and general practices.
Operates and maintains a variety of computer technology and audio-visual equipment and assists other staff in the performance of clerical.
Other duties as assigned to gain experience with other work groups at Pinnacles.

Additional Position and Community Information:

Pinnacles National Park is in central California. It is in a rural portion of the central coast area.It is about 2 hours from San Francisco.The closest towns or cities are,Soledadand Greenfield, near the west side of the park.Hollister is about 30 miles north of the east side park.King City is also about 30 miles south of the east side of the park.The yearly visitation at the park is about 350,000 visitors per year.

The position may be located on the east or west side of the park. The drive time between the two sides is about 1 hours since there is no road between the two sides in the park. The busiest of the year, is the springtime, from late February to May.
